Of all the seasons and holidays in the year, Christmas is possibly the most celebrated holiday throughout the world. We usually know the season is near when we start to hear those familiar Christmas songs, such as White Christmas, being played in practically every store we step into. Of all the celebrated holidays, Christmas is the one holiday that has songs written specifically in celebration of it. Christmas songs have a special way of cheering the spirit and putting people in that special Christmas mood.

There are some well-known Christmas songs that are known throughout the world such as, Silent Night, Jingle Bells, O Little Town of Bethlehem, and White Christmas. There are many compositions of the songs. Some Christmas songs are upbeat, and other Christmas songs have a more classical tone to them. One thing that remains is the words, or lyrics, of the Christmas songs.

In ancient times, the apostles would sing songs or praise based on psalms and would sing these songs to the masses as a form of teaching. These days, as we listen to the lyrics of Christmas songs they have meanings to them. Some Christmas songs, such as Christ is Born in Bethlehem, We Three Kings, Silent Night, or Angels We Have Heard on High are songs that tell the story of the birth of Jesus. Other Christmas songs tell the tale of Santa Claus and his reindeers, such as Rudolph the Red Nosed Reindeer or The Night Before Christmas.

Almost all Christmas songs, no matter the time of year that it is played, bring a feeling of good cheer to those who hear it. There is something about Christmas songs that bring a feeling of happiness, and uplift our spirits. It could possibly be linked to our childhood, when we would learn these songs knowing that Christmas was arriving and presents would soon be placed under the tree if we were on our best behavior.

Christmas somehow brings the best out in many of us. Christmas is a time of happiness, good cheer, good will, and charity. There is just something about Christmas that causes us to become more caring and giving towards others.

As with any music, Christmas songs can lighten your mood, entertain you, and uplift you. That is often why some people prefer not to listen to Christmas songs only during the Christmas season, but throughout the year. However, there is something special about listening to Christmas songs only during the Christmas season, as they may lose their touch if heard throughout the year. Whatever the season though, Christmas songs will always bring a bit of cheer to anyone.
